A new £2 billion property delivery joint venture (JV) has been created between Morgan Sindall and Hertfordshire County Council.
Chalkdene Developments has been created between the council's own property company, Herts Living Ltd and Morgan Sindall Investments' subsidiary, Community Solutions for Regeneration (Hertfordshire) Limited (‘CSRH').
The JV will focus on delivering new homes and jobs across the county in 12 locations, with the capacity to deliver over 500 properties at around 40 sites. The partnership agreement is for 15 years, with the option to extend to a further five.
The 50/50 partnership will also benefit from working with other companies within the Morgan Sindall Group to deliver the works at pace, including partnership homes developer, Lovell, and the Construction and Infrastructure division.
The JV also has the potential to deliver schemes under the Government's One Public Estate initiative and on behalf of other public sector authorities in addition to Hertfordshire County Council.
